Stars of Today: Mannes and Jazz Students Perform Throughout NYC
New York in the summer is alive with musical entertainment. And across Manhattan, free performances by The New School’s jazz and classical students have become something of a summer tradition.
Starting in June, students from The New School for Jazz and Contemporary Music can be found performing in the lunchtime music series Jazz in the Square taking place every Tuesday from June 12 through August 7 at 12:00 to 1:30 p.m. in the West Side Seating Area of Union Square Park.
While students from Mannes College The New School for Music can be found performing every Friday from 6:30-8:30 p.m. at the Morgan Library & Museum, 225 Madison Avenue, in Gilbert Court right across from the Morgan Cafâ©.
But that’s just the beginning. The university’s two music divisions are featured exclusively at the Hudson River Park’s Stars of Tomorrow music series.
Alternating between performances by combos from New School Jazz and chamber ensembles from Mannes College, the free concerts will showcase a wide array of the university’s musical offerings. All performances start at 6:30, and take place at Pier 45 at Christopher Street. Read on for a full schedule of performances, and see you where the music is!
